`
experience
  • 浏览: 196452 次
社区版块
存档分类
最新评论

Best and Worst Practices for Mock Objects

 
阅读更多
http://codebetter.com/blogs/jeremy.miller/archive/...Mock objects are like any other tool. Used one way they’re a huge time saver. In other cases they can easily create more work and degrade the quality of the testing code. In this post I’ll try to present some best and worst practices for utilizing mock objects. Sadly, every “bad” practice described is something I’ve either done or seen done.
分享到:
评论

相关推荐

    SEO Best And Worst Practices

    在探讨SEO最佳与最差实践时,我们首先要理解SEO(搜索引擎优化)的本质,它是一种提升网站在搜索引擎自然搜索结果中的可见度的技术。以下是从给定文件中提炼的关键知识点,涵盖SEO的最佳实践、最差实践及其解释,...

    Worst Practices in SOA

    John Senor在《Worst Practices in SOA》一文中揭示的这些问题,是许多企业在实施SOA过程中经常遇到的陷阱。通过对这些最坏实践的理解和规避,以及借鉴iWay Software提出的响应措施,企业可以更有效地推进SOA项目,...

    港股公司研究-招银国际-JS环球生活Hope for the best and prepare for the worst

    【JS环球生活——港股公司研究】 JS环球生活在港股市场中占据了一席之地,其主要业务涉及家用电器领域,尤其在小家电市场上具有显著影响力。公司由多位重要股东控制,其中包括董事长王孙宁及其一致行动人持有56.43%...

    Android代码-安卓系统魔方计时器

    English Main features: Supports all WCA's official scrambles, including random-state ...Multiple session: shows best/worst time, average/mean of any times, best average/mean and session mean/average. S

    新概念英语第二册lessonThebestandtheworstPPT课件.pptx

    本PPT课件主要介绍了新概念英语第二册的 lesson The best and the worst,涵盖了英语语法、词汇、句子结构等多方面的知识点。 1. 英语语法:本课件中出现了多种英语语法结构,如完成时、一般现在时、一般过去时等。...

    2020-2021算法分析与设计期末试题1

    算法是计算机科学的核心部分,它涉及到解决问题的有效方法和数据处理。在本题中,主要涵盖了多个算法相关的知识点,包括哈夫曼编码、最短路径算法、背包问题、算法的特性、动态规划、贪婪算法、分支界限法、时间...

    遗传算法(Genetic Algorithm Developed by Prof. Kalyanmoy Deb)

    Genetic Algorithm Developed By : Prof. Kalyanmoy Deb with assistance from his Students. This is a GA implementation using ...plotting best, avg, and worst population fitness versus generation number.

    新概念英语第二册lessonThe best and the worstPPT课件.pptx

    这篇PPT课件是关于新概念英语第二册的一课,主题为"The best and the worst",主要教授比较级和最高级的用法,同时也涵盖了一些词汇和表达的讲解。以下是相关的知识点: 1. **比较级和最高级**: - 课件中通过"I ...

    Next Generation SOA

    Fortunately, with SOA’s growth, best practices and use cases for successful implementation are now emerging. This book captures the most valuable of these – and presents them simply, accessibly, ...

    内存分配算法,包括first-fit,best-fit等

    * 内存利用率:best-fit 算法和 worst-fit 算法可以尽量减少内存的浪费和碎片化,而 first-fit 算法可能会产生碎片化。 * 算法复杂度:first-fit 算法的算法复杂度最低,而 best-fit 算法和 worst-fit 算法的算法...

    第4章-实验2-模拟BestFit算法1

    【BestFit算法详解】 最佳适应算法(Best Fit, 简称BF)是动态分区存储管理策略中的一种,主要用于分配和管理内存空间。在BF算法中,系统维护一个空闲分区表,其中的分区按其大小从小到大排序。当有新的内存请求时...

    Aeronautical Channel Modeling

    Typical and worst case parameter sets are suggested, based on published measurement results and empirical data. The models are suitable for channel emulators that can be easily implemented on digital...

    Fast and Scalable Range Query Processing

    Privacy has been the key road block to cloud computing as clouds may not be fully trusted. This paper is concerned ... For example, for a query whose results contain 10 data items, it takes only 0.17 ms.

    np难问题近似算法(绝版好书)

    2.2.3 Best fit, worst fit, and almost any fit algorithms 2.2.4 Bounded-space online algorithms 2.2.5 Arbitrary online algorithms 2.2.6 Semi-online algorithms 2.2.7 First fit decreasing and best fit ...

    worst_case_optimization_自适应波束形成_

    "worst_case_optimization_自适应波束形成_"这一标题揭示了我们讨论的主题是关于自适应波束形成的一种特殊策略,即最差性能最优法(Worst-Case Optimization)。 自适应波束形成的目标通常是在多个方向上优化信号...

    worst-case.rar_RAB_Worst-case_worst case_波束 稳健_稳健波束形成

    在IT行业中,尤其是在无线通信和信号处理领域,"worst-case.rar_RAB_Worst-case_worst case_波束 稳健_稳健波束形成"这个标题和描述涉及到的关键技术是"稳健波束形成"(Robust Beamforming)。这是一种优化无线通信...

Global site tag (gtag.js) - Google Analytics